Adolescents and Abusive Behaviours in their Intimate Relationships

Nearly half of teenage children who have been in a relationship have experienced violent or controlling behaviours from a partner.

Based on a survey of 10,000 children aged 13 to 17 across England and Wales, the ‘How do boys and girls experience violence’ report found that 27% of teens have been in a relationship over the past year, and of those, 49% experience some form of violent or controlling behaviour. Youth Endowment Fund 2025

Come on this multi-agency course to increase your confidence in identifying the issue and learn how to support young people and their families and respond effectively.
